Output 82b23e2336c0ec1423a8ef5e2da29201461601d55d39a62aee30494928918233:0

value
1430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42d8d3cd7dbd27f4658af5d6a2187618acd30031 OP_EQUAL
address
37nUGdgWs1tkmdUUBD1SYuFkP7eQFH116T
transaction
82b23e2336c0ec1423a8ef5e2da29201461601d55d39a62aee30494928918233
spent
true